Job Responsibilities
Source Worksheet Preparation
- Prepare data capture tools including various source worksheets, schedules, logs, and other forms as required to facilitate accurate and complete data capture according to the study protocol.
- Involves the meticulous review of study protocols and related documents to ensure sites capture and perform all necessary assessments for subject visits, including consent documentation and clinical assessments.
- Review all available study documentation to ensure the accuracy and completeness of the data capture tools prepared, to prevent protocol deviations at sites. This includes but is not limited to the study protocol, CRF, CRF Completion Guidelines, manuals (laboratory, pharmacy, photography, etc.), sponsor source worksheets/tools, and patient materials.
- Identify and address potential issues such as missing details or contradictory instructions in the provided study documentation to ensure that clear and correct instructions are provided in data capture tools.
- Update and create new source worksheets as needed following protocol amendments and other updated documents (e.g., CRF, sponsor source worksheets, patient materials) to ensure continued accurate and complete data capture.
- Regularly monitor recruitment at PMR-affiliated sites to determine if/when additional source worksheets will be required.
- Meet deadlines for providing data capture tools to PMR-affiliated sites as per Source Worksheet Development Work Instructions, to avoid delays in subject enrollment and scheduled study visits.
